Can No Follow Links Hurt You?
As SEOs, we know that any outgoing links from our site on which we use nofollow will not be counted; they don’t pass link juice. It’s a common practice with links in blog comments. But what if nofollow links point TO your website? Could they actually hurt you…especially in these post-Penguin days?

Using Semantics for Keyword Research
Semantics concerns the meaning of words – historically a weak area for search engines. Over the years we’ve seen vast improvement in Google’s ability to understand what searchers mean when they enter keywords. You can capitalize on this fact by changing the way you conduct keyword research. Following these tips will also strengthen your website’s content.
